One small advise.
I rode my dazzler below 65km/hr /below 4.5k rpm before first service.
I tested my mileage just after first service. I got 55.7km/l.
Then I rode her very rashly, ie I touched 90-100 now and then. Now when I tested mileage even riding in economy way, I got only 47. So I think what I should have done is slowly increase the higher rpm limit, else it will cause problems to engine. Now its done 1900km. waiting for second service. Hope there will be some improvement then.

As per your requirements,
For riding pleasure in traffic and good distances, All the ones you listed do pretty much good job. GS150r, Hunk & Unicorn would be on heavier side with 149Kg, 146Kg, 146kg kerb weight receptively.
- All of the bikes which you mentioned are by the Japanese Kings, (3 of them have same Honda engine) you shouldn't go wrong with any of em on maintenance and reliability .
Except for the college going part, I had pretty much same requirements and I have chosen Dazzler. I was more into FZ16 but (around)10kmpl difference & Honda badge made me lean towards Dazzler. Its done 2050KM in about 20 Days and I still can't wait to get back on it. Did a 750KM trip in two days, no back aches or engine problem
I would recommend you to test-ride all of them, as its your experience that counts. The bike on which you get the widest smile, Buy it.
